Hobo With A Shotgun - 7/10. This started as a spoof trailer in the Grindhouse films, but then actually got made with Rutger Hauer as the lead character. Despite being a 2011 release they shot it in Technicolor to give that authentic 70s look. Gory, funny and low budget, its definitely worth a watch.

There's two long tabs at the rear of the tray so you have to make sure they are lined up and then push it in flat. It could be your fusebox has come loose from the holder, have a look to see if it is resting in a notch on either side.

http://www.motorsportatthepalace.co.uk/ Motorsport at the Palace for you London and Surrey types. Held in Crystal Palace park and easily accessible by bus and train. And car too! I'll be there as I live about half a mile away :) Classic car show with a timed sprint event on part of the old race track that is now, sadly, no longer complete.
